A Brief Journey through the Life and Work of the Master of Suspense, Discovering the Genius behind the Pages.
David Baldacci was born on August 5, 1960 in Richmond, Virginia, USA. From an early age, he displayed a love of reading and writing, inspired by the stories of mystery and adventure that he voraciously devoured. He began writing short stories from the age of ten, displaying an innate talent that would only grow with time. After graduating in Law from the University of Virginia, Baldacci practiced law in Washington D.C. However, his passion for writing never left him, and he continued to write in his spare time, fueling his dream of becoming an author.

In 1996, Baldacci published his first novel, "Absolute Power", which immediately became a bestseller and catapulted the author to international fame. The plot, which mixes political suspense with ethical dilemmas, demonstrated Baldacci's exceptional narrative talent. "Absolute Power" was adapted to film in 1997, starring Clint Eastwood and Gene Hackman, further cementing Baldacci's reputation as a master of the thriller. Since then, Baldacci has written numerous novels, each receiving praise from critics and readers alike. His ability to weave complex stories full of suspense and emotion has made him one of the best-selling authors in the world.
